Offensive Coordinator Eric Kresser Promoted To Head Coach

Offensive coordinator Eric Kresser has been appointed Head Football Coach following the retirement of Ron Ream as Head Coach after 37 years. Kresser has spent the past four years as Benjamin’s Offensive Coordinator and has worked closely with Louisville commit Jordan Travis.

"We are very excited that Eric Kresser has accepted the position of Head Football Coach,” said Athletic Director Ryan Smith ‘93.

“Eric brings extensive experience and success as both a player and coach. It was an easy and natural selection with regards to Eric as he has been the offensive coordinator for the past four seasons and teaches physical education at the School. He understands the culture, values, and mission of School. We are certain Eric will continue with the incredible program that Ron Ream managed for 37 years,” said Smith.

Kresser was inducted into the Palm Beach County Sports Hall of Fame after playing for three years in the NFL for the Cincinnati Bengals. Kresser, a former Benjamin student, played for The University of Florida and Marshall University before joining the NFL.
